In one of the little shopping malls attached to the supermarket, I found
an internet cafe, and walked inside. I had to wait about 5 minutes for a
terminal to be free, but it was relatively inexpensive (N$10 for 30
minutes), and had a fast connection. More importantly, I was able to
"telnet" in to check my email (rather than being web-based, my email is on a
unix shell account, and I can only access it if the internet cafe allows
"telnet" from their system. Throughout my trip, most allowed this, but a
few did block the function on their machines).
